Complete Buyer's Guide: How to Choose Gas Pool Heaters for Inground Pools
1. Understanding BTU Requirements
BTU (British Thermal Unit) measures heating power, and getting this right is crucial for inground pools. As a general rule, you’ll need 20-50 BTUs per gallon of water, but pool size, climate, and desired temperature rise all affect this calculation. For most residential inground pools, 100,000-400,000 BTUs is the sweet spot—smaller pools (under 15,000 gallons) do well with 100,000-150,000 BTUs, while larger pools (20,000+ gallons) need 200,000+ BTUs for effective heating.
During testing, I found that undersized heaters run constantly without reaching desired temperatures, while oversized units cycle on and off too frequently, reducing efficiency and lifespan. Measure your pool’s gallonage accurately and consider your local climate—colder regions typically need higher BTU ratings.
2. Fuel Type: Natural Gas vs Propane
Most inground pool heaters use either natural gas or propane, and your choice depends largely on what’s available in your area. Natural gas is generally more cost-effective if you have existing gas lines, while propane offers flexibility for rural locations without gas infrastructure. During my evaluations, natural gas models tended to have slightly better efficiency ratings, but modern propane heaters like the Pentair MasterTemp closed that gap significantly.
Consider installation costs too—running new gas lines can add thousands to your project, while propane tanks require regular delivery and maintenance. I always recommend checking local fuel availability and costs before making your decision.
3. Energy Efficiency Matters
Pool heater efficiency is measured by thermal efficiency percentage, with most gas models ranging from 80-95%. Higher efficiency means less fuel waste and lower operating costs—something I noticed significantly during extended testing. Models like the Pentair series achieve 82% efficiency through advanced combustion technology, while others might be less efficient but more affordable upfront.
Look for features like electronic ignition (instead of standing pilots) and good heat exchanger design. Remember that a slightly more efficient heater might cost more initially but save you money over several swimming seasons through reduced gas consumption.
4. Durability and Construction Quality
Inground pool heaters face harsh conditions—chemical exposure, weather elements, and temperature fluctuations. Heat exchanger material is particularly important; copper-nickel and cupro nickel alloys (like in Hayward models) resist corrosion better than standard copper. During testing, I paid close attention to how well each unit’s exterior held up to simulated weather conditions.
User feedback revealed that models with better corrosion protection lasted years longer, while those with cheaper materials showed rust and deterioration within the first season. Don’t underestimate build quality—it’s the difference between a heater that lasts five years versus one that lasts fifteen.

Frequently Asked Questions
1. What size gas pool heater do I need for my inground pool?
Pool heater size depends on your pool’s gallonage, desired temperature increase, and local climate. A good starting point is 20-50 BTUs per gallon—so a 20,000-gallon pool would need 400,000-1,000,000 BTUs. However, most residential inground pools do well with 100,000-400,000 BTUs. Smaller pools (under 15,000 gallons) can use 100,000-150,000 BTU heaters, while larger pools need 200,000+ BTUs. Consider how quickly you want to heat the pool and your climate—colder areas generally require more powerful heaters.
2. How efficient are gas pool heaters compared to other types?
Gas pool heaters typically have thermal efficiency ratings between 80-95%, meaning they convert most of the fuel’s energy into heat. They’re generally less efficient than heat pumps (which can reach 300-600% efficiency) but much more effective in colder weather. The key advantage of gas heaters is their fast heating capability—they can raise pool temperatures quickly, while heat pumps work gradually. During testing, I found gas heaters ideal for extending swimming seasons in transitional weather when you want quick warmth rather than constant heating.

4. How long do gas pool heaters typically last?
With proper maintenance, a quality gas pool heater should last 5-10 years, though some well-maintained units reach 15+ years. Durability depends heavily on construction materials—heat exchangers made from cupro nickel or copper-nickel alloys tend to last longer than standard copper. During testing, I noticed that models with better corrosion protection and regular maintenance showed significantly longer lifespans. Environmental factors also matter; heaters in saltwater pools or harsh climates may need replacement sooner.
5. What maintenance does a gas pool heater require?
Regular maintenance is crucial for longevity and efficiency. You should clean the heater annually to remove debris, check for corrosion or leaks, and ensure proper ventilation. Many modern heaters have self-diagnostic systems that alert you to issues. During testing, I found that simple maintenance like keeping the area clear and checking connections periodically prevented most common problems. Consider professional servicing every 2-3 years for thorough inspection and parts replacement if needed.
